Underpinning Repair in Tampa, FL
Underpinning repair services focus on stabilizing and strengthening the foundation of a property when issues such as settling, shifting, or cracks are present. This process involves installing additional support beneath the existing foundation to ensure the structure remains safe and level. Projects typically include addressing foundation settlement in residential homes, fixing uneven floors, repairing cracks in walls, or supporting structures affected by soil movement. Property owners considering underpinning often want to understand the scope of the repair, the methods used to stabilize the foundation, and how the work can prevent further damage or costly repairs in the future.
Before requesting underpinning services, homeowners should assess the signs of foundation problems, such as visible cracks, sticking doors or windows, or uneven flooring. It is also helpful to understand the potential causes of foundation movement, including soil conditions or water drainage issues, to ensure the correct solution is implemented. Clarifying the extent of the damage and the necessary repairs can aid in making informed decisions about foundation stabilization. Proper evaluation and planning are essential steps in ensuring the long-term stability and safety of the property.

Common Underpinning Repair Jobs
Foundation underpinning - stabilizes and strengthens compromised foundations to prevent further settling.
Pier and beam repair - restores support for homes built on piers or beams that have shifted or sunk.
Settlement correction - addresses uneven ground or soil movement causing structural instability.
Crack repair - seals and reinforces cracks in the foundation to improve durability.
Soil stabilization - improves soil conditions beneath the foundation to reduce future movement.
Structural reinforcement - enhances existing foundation support to maintain long-term stability.
Underpinning Repair Questions
What is underpinning repair? It involves strengthening or stabilizing the foundation of a building to prevent settling or movement.
When is underpinning necessary? It is needed when a building shows signs of foundation settlement, such as cracks or uneven floors.
What types of projects typically require underpinning? Underpinning is common in home additions, foundation repairs, or when correcting uneven settling of a structure.
How does underpinning improve a property? It stabilizes the foundation, helping to prevent further damage and maintain structural integrity.
